Spouses and Children of Soldiers in the following statuses are eligible to apply for our scholarship programs:
Active Duty, Deceased Active, Retired, Deceased Retired, Medically Retired, Grey Area Retiree, AGR and ARNG / USAR on Title 10 Orders for the entire Academic Year for which they are applying.
Applicants must be listed as dependents of their Soldier Sponsor in DEERS.
Applicants for the MG James Ursano Children's Scholarship Program must be under the age of 24.
Recipients must be pursuing their first undergraduate degree (exceptions may be made for Spouse Scholarship applicants) at a college or university listed in the US Department of Education's accreditation database. Trade schools are acceptable as well.
